Cost of independent living in Trails End, IN

The average cost of senior living in Trails End is $2,981 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Indianapolis, IN with an average of $2,718 per month.

Independent living costs in Trails End, IN, over time

The line graph below shows how monthly independent living costs have shifted over the past five years in Trails End and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ent quarterly averages of what seniors actually paid after moving into A Place for Mom partner communities.

Trails End, ININ stateNational

Independent living cost trends in Trails End, IN

The table below shows how monthly independent living costs in Trails End have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Trails End, IN$2,594/mo$2,655/mo-2.3%
Indiana$2,786/mo$2,768/mo+0.6%
National$3,416/mo$3,319/mo+2.9%
